While recieving mail containing charset=MACINTOSH as MIME, Thunderbird can't
read correctly "special characters".

It shows "�" char instead of showing chars like é, è, à etc.

For example (in french) it shows the following text :
"installes un �diteur de texte"
instead of :
"installes un éditeur de texte"

Reproducible: Always

Steps to Reproduce:
1. A mail was send by a "Macintosh" computer using charset "MACINTOSH" and
special chars
2. Read the message with thunderbird

Actual Results:  
text sample :

installes un �diteur de texte

Expected Results:  
installes un éditeur de texte
